Feelings: These are quite exciting times at Ramen and Friends. SS, AP and the Gang (my lovely new co workers) arranged our first ramen outing at this midtown Japanese lunch spot. The place is cramped and crowded, and it definietely gives you that authentic hole-in-the-wall feel a la Tampopo by Juzo Itami. They even give you a check as they bring out your dish, which reminded me the way ramen restaurants run in Osaka. Listen up Ippudo, this is the way ramen places should be! My Shoyu ramen was on the slightly salty side, but this might be one of the few places where you can get decent, efficient, fast, and delicious meals at a reasonable price. And in Times Square of all places!
